Cold rolled steel plate represents one of the most versatile and widely utilized materials in modern manufacturing and construction industries. This specialized steel product undergoes a unique manufacturing process where the steel is passed through rollers at room temperature, resulting in enhanced mechanical properties and superior surface quality compared to hot rolled alternatives. The cold rolling process involves reducing the thickness of the steel through compression while maintaining precise dimensional tolerances and achieving exceptional surface smoothness. Cold rolled steel plate exhibits remarkable strength characteristics, offering higher yield strength and tensile strength than hot rolled steel due to the work hardening that occurs during the rolling process. The manufacturing technique creates a dense, uniform grain structure that contributes to improved mechanical properties and consistent performance across various applications. This steel variant demonstrates excellent formability, making it ideal for complex shaping operations and precision manufacturing requirements. The surface finish of cold rolled steel plate is notably superior, featuring a smooth, clean appearance that often eliminates the need for additional surface treatments. Cold rolled steel plate maintains excellent dimensional accuracy, with tighter tolerances that ensure consistent thickness and flatness throughout the material. The controlled rolling environment allows manufacturers to achieve precise specifications while maintaining material integrity. This steel type offers enhanced corrosion resistance compared to some alternatives, particularly when proper protective coatings are applied. Cold rolled steel plate demonstrates exceptional weldability, allowing for seamless integration into fabricated structures and assemblies. The material exhibits uniform hardness distribution, ensuring predictable performance in demanding applications. Modern production techniques ensure that cold rolled steel plate meets stringent quality standards while maintaining cost-effectiveness for large-scale industrial applications across automotive, construction, appliance manufacturing, and precision engineering sectors.

Superior Surface Quality and Precision Manufacturing

Superior Surface Quality and Precision Manufacturing

Cold rolled steel plate achieves unmatched surface quality through its specialized manufacturing process, delivering mirror-like finishes that eliminate surface irregularities and provide consistent texture across entire sheets. This exceptional surface quality stems from the controlled rolling environment where steel passes through precision rollers at room temperature, creating smooth, uniform surfaces free from scale, oxidation, and surface defects commonly found in hot rolled alternatives. The precision manufacturing process ensures dimensional accuracy within extremely tight tolerances, typically achieving thickness variations of less than 0.002 inches across standard sheet dimensions. This level of precision eliminates the need for costly secondary machining operations and reduces material waste significantly. Manufacturers working with cold rolled steel plate benefit from immediate surface preparation advantages, as the clean, smooth finish readily accepts paints, coatings, and adhesives without extensive surface treatment requirements. The superior surface quality translates directly into improved product aesthetics and enhanced coating adhesion, extending the service life of finished products while reducing maintenance requirements. Quality control measures during production ensure consistent surface characteristics throughout each manufacturing run, providing reliability for high-volume production applications where uniformity is critical. The smooth surface finish also contributes to improved safety in handling and processing, reducing the risk of cuts and injuries associated with rough or scaled surfaces. Cold rolled steel plate surface quality enables precision printing and graphic applications, making it suitable for decorative panels, appliance exteriors, and architectural elements where appearance is paramount. The consistent surface texture facilitates accurate measurement and inspection procedures, streamlining quality assurance processes and reducing inspection time. Manufacturing efficiency improves significantly when using cold rolled steel plate due to reduced preparation requirements, faster processing speeds, and improved tool life resulting from the smooth, consistent surface characteristics that minimize wear and friction during fabrication operations.
Enhanced Mechanical Properties and Structural Performance

Enhanced Mechanical Properties and Structural Performance

Cold rolled steel plate exhibits superior mechanical properties achieved through the work hardening effect that occurs during the room temperature rolling process, resulting in significantly higher yield strength and tensile strength compared to hot rolled steel alternatives. This strength enhancement typically increases yield strength by 15-20 percent while maintaining excellent ductility and formability characteristics essential for complex manufacturing applications. The controlled deformation during cold rolling creates a refined grain structure with improved uniformity, contributing to enhanced fatigue resistance and improved stress distribution under dynamic loading conditions. These mechanical improvements enable engineers to design more efficient structures using thinner gauge materials while maintaining required load-bearing capacity, resulting in weight reduction and material cost savings. Cold rolled steel plate demonstrates exceptional strain hardening capabilities, allowing the material to strengthen further during forming operations while maintaining dimensional stability and surface integrity. The enhanced mechanical properties provide superior performance in high-stress applications including automotive structural components, appliance frameworks, and precision machinery parts where reliability is crucial. Consistent mechanical properties throughout each sheet eliminate performance variations that can compromise product quality and safety margins in critical applications. The improved strength-to-weight ratio achieved through cold rolling makes this material ideal for applications requiring maximum performance with minimal material usage. Cold rolled steel plate maintains excellent elastic properties, providing superior spring-back characteristics during forming operations and enabling precise dimensional control in complex shapes. The enhanced mechanical properties extend beyond basic strength measurements to include improved impact resistance, better fracture toughness, and superior wear resistance in applications involving sliding or rolling contact. Quality assurance testing confirms that cold rolled steel plate maintains consistent mechanical properties across production runs, ensuring reliable performance predictions and simplified engineering calculations. The combination of high strength and excellent formability allows manufacturers to achieve complex geometries while maintaining structural integrity, expanding design possibilities and enabling innovative product development in competitive markets where performance advantages translate directly into commercial success.
Exceptional Formability and Manufacturing Versatility

Exceptional Formability and Manufacturing Versatility

Cold rolled steel plate offers unparalleled formability characteristics that enable complex shaping operations including deep drawing, progressive forming, and precision bending without compromising material integrity or creating surface defects. This exceptional formability results from the controlled microstructure achieved during the cold rolling process, which creates optimal grain orientation and uniform material properties throughout the sheet thickness. The superior ductility of cold rolled steel plate allows for dramatic shape changes during forming operations, enabling manufacturers to produce complex geometries that would be impossible with less formable materials. Deep drawing applications particularly benefit from the excellent formability, as the material flows smoothly into complex die cavities without thinning, wrinkling, or tearing that commonly occurs with inferior materials. Progressive stamping operations achieve higher production rates and improved dimensional accuracy when using cold rolled steel plate due to the consistent material response and predictable forming behavior throughout each coil or sheet. The formability advantages extend to roll forming operations where the material maintains dimensional stability while being shaped into profiles, channels, and complex cross-sections required for structural and architectural applications. Cold rolled steel plate demonstrates excellent bendability with minimal spring-back, enabling precise angle formation and consistent dimensional control in bent components. The material exhibits superior stretch forming capabilities, allowing for the production of large, smooth contoured surfaces required in automotive panels and appliance housings. Manufacturing versatility increases significantly with cold rolled steel plate as the material adapts readily to various forming processes including hydroforming, spinning, and incremental forming techniques. Quality consistency during forming operations ensures repeatable results with minimal setup adjustments, reducing production time and material waste while improving overall manufacturing efficiency. The excellent formability characteristics enable just-in-time manufacturing approaches where complex parts can be produced quickly and reliably to meet changing market demands. Cold rolled steel plate maintains its formability advantages across various thickness ranges, providing design flexibility for applications requiring different strength and weight requirements while preserving the ability to create complex shapes efficiently and economically.
